Currently, first class R Data Frame/RDBMS style joins are not accessible from the datadr API unless one divides by a unique key (creating singleton chunks of data) and then combines on keys. Considering that data from one cohesive set may be stored in numerous files but with shared unique keys, having joins for such data is necessary before the full set can be used.
